Bathtub Demolition in Bergen County, NJ

Bathtub demolition services involve the careful removal of existing bathtubs to prepare for renovations, replacements, or remodeling projects. This process typically includes the demolition of the tub itself, along with surrounding fixtures, tiles, and any supporting structures that need to be cleared out. Property owners often request this service when upgrading an outdated or damaged bathtub, creating more space in a bathroom, or making way for new fixtures and designs. It is important for homeowners to understand the scope of demolition involved, potential disposal requirements, and any impact on plumbing or surrounding surfaces before requesting this service.

Before requesting bathtub demolition, property owners should consider the condition of the existing bathtub and the extent of work needed. Clarifying whether only the tub needs removal or if additional demolition, such as tearing out tiles or walls, is required can help ensure proper planning. Additionally, understanding access points, potential debris removal needs, and the impact on bathroom functionality can help set realistic expectations. Proper planning and communication can facilitate a smoother demolition process, whether for a simple bathtub replacement or a more extensive bathroom renovation.

Common Bathtub Demolition Jobs

Bathtub Removal - safely removing outdated or damaged tubs for replacement or renovation.

Full Demolition - tearing out entire bathtub enclosures and surrounding structures.

Partial Demolition - removing only specific sections of the bathtub or enclosure for upgrades.

Custom Demolition - tailored demolition solutions for unique bathroom layouts or design changes.

Hazardous Material Removal - safely handling and disposing of asbestos or mold-contaminated components.

Site Clearing - preparing the bathroom space for new fixtures or remodeling projects.

Bathtub Demolition Questions

What is involved in bathtub demolition? Bathtub demolition typically includes removing the old fixture, disconnecting plumbing, and preparing the space for a new installation or renovation.

Are there different types of bathtub demolition services? Yes, services may include complete removal, partial demolition, or specialized techniques for difficult-to-access tubs.

What should property owners consider before a demolition project? It's important to evaluate access points, plumbing connections, and the overall condition of the surrounding area.

Is bathtub demolition suitable for remodeling projects? Yes, it is often a necessary step in bathroom renovations or upgrades to create a clean, ready space for new fixtures.
